There are many occasions on which you can be expected to talk about your firm. This may include actually showing someone physically around the place of work or premises. But it may more generally involve referring to the way in which the company is organized and run.
Firms are a very important part of the economy. They are responsible for producing goods and services. Businesses come in every shape and size. While the vast majority of the world’s businesses are small, large firms often dominate the economy in some countries. Indeed, the income of the world’s largest fifty industrial companies added together represents more than haft the total output of the United States.
Large businesses differ very much from small ones in a wide variety of ways. In many countries there are both private firms and nationalized firms belonging to the government. A small private firm may have just one owner but a very large firm has thousands of shareholders.
In very large firms the owners have very little to do with the day-to-day running of the firm. This is left to the management. Very large companies may be organized into several large departments, or sometimes even divisions. The organizational structure of some companies is very hierarchical with the board of directors at the top and the various departmental heads reporting to them. Often the only time shareholders can influence the board is at yearly shareholders’ meetings.
Some firms may only produce one product or service. Others may produce many different products: in fact they may seem to be like a collection of businesses inside one company. The bigger a business becomes the further it may expand geographically. Many large firms have manufacturing plants and trading locations in several different countries spread around the world.
